You are here
HIGH STANDARD CONSULTING LIMITED (Malta) - Phone - Address
HIGH STANDARD CONSULTING LIMITED is a Malta company, located in SLIEMA SLM1278, you can browse HIGH STANDARD CONSULTING LIMITED phone, address, contact person, products and services, website, and etc for free. HIGH STANDARD CONSULTING LIMITED business info all on bizdirlib.com.